Product Description
SABIC® LDPE Powder 2102TZ500 is an additive free standard CTR® tubular grade for masterbatch with a relatively low melt flow rate. This grade is supplied in powder form. SABIC® LDPE Powder 2102TZ500 is a general medium sized powder grade for textile coating, carpet backing and compounding applications with a low viscosity. Further it is suited for low filled or additive masterbatches (e.g. slip agents, anti fog agents, anti static agents, thermal stabilizers).
